Production process

The primary function of the machinery described by hs code 844513 is to transform raw textile fibres, such as cotton, wool, or synthetic materials, into a continuous strand or 'roving' that can then be spun into yarn. This is achieved through a series of mechanical processes that include carding, drawing, and roving. Carding disentangles and aligns the fibres, while drawing and roving further refine the material, creating a uniform and consistent roving that is ready for spinning.
